February

* 9 February - The first time that Hong Kong recorded more than 1,000 COVID-19 infections in one day. * 10 February - Vaccine Pass scheme launched. * 15 February - Chinese Communist Party leader Xi Jinping stressed to the Hong Kong government which must take the “main responsibility” in containing coronavirus pandemic and placing top priority on stability and people’s lives. * 25 February - The first time that Hong Kong recorded more than 10,000 COVID-19 infections in one day.


March

* 1 March – New Subscriber Identification Module ( SIM Card) require real-name registration by the government. * 2 March - The first time that Hong Kong recorded more than 50,000 COVID-19 infections in one day.

November

* 30 November – The Small Unmanned Aircraft Order Enforced. Small unmanned aircraft (including small unmanned aerial photography aircraft) over 200 gram and remote pilots proceeds officially registration. Remote pilots who drive over 7 kg unmanned aircraft (including aerial photography aircraft) need to take training and pass the formal assessment accepted by the government. *
